Pros of Online CPR Courses
Flexibility
One considerable advantage of on-line training courses is flexibility. Learners can choose when and where they intend to examine without requiring to adhere to a rigorous schedule.
Accessibility
On the internet programs can be accessed from anywhere with an internet connection. This is especially valuable for those residing in remote areas or with minimal access to physical training centers.
Cost-Effectiveness
Often, on-line programs are cheaper than their in-person counterparts as a result of reduced overhead costs associated with maintaining physical classrooms.
Self-Paced Learning
Trainees have the capability to discover at their very own rate-- evaluating materials multiple times if needed prior to attempting assessments.
Variety of Resources
Lots of on the internet programs provide an array of knowing devices including videos showing strategies like DRSABCD (Danger, Feedback, Send out for assistance, Respiratory tract, Breathing, Circulation).
Convenience
Getting rid of travel time conserves both time and money; you can complete your training from the convenience of your home.
Cons of Online CPR Courses
Limited Hands-On Practice
While concept can be found out on the internet properly, exercising lifesaving strategies requires hands-on experience that may not be properly covered without supervision.
Less Immediate Feedback
On-line training courses may do not have real-time communication with teachers that can offer immediate comments on method execution.
Motivation Levels
Self-control is required for on-line knowing; some people may have a hard time to remain inspired without an organized classroom environment.
Technical Issues
Dependence on technology indicates potential issues like poor internet connection might impede discovering experiences.
Certification Validity
Not all employers identify qualifications obtained through on-line systems as equal to those obtained with typical methods.

Pros of In-Person CPR Courses
Hands-On Experience

Immediate Teacher Feedback
Learners obtain prompt feedback on their performance from instructors that can remedy errors in real-time.
Structured Environment
The classroom setup fosters a self-displined approach towards learning while supplying an appealing ambience with peers.
Networking Opportunities
Attending courses enables you to get in touch with other individuals interested in healthcare or emergency situation feedback training-- possibly leading to future collaborations.
Enhanced Emphasis Levels
Being literally present lowers diversions contrasted to researching at home where disruptions may occur frequently.
Accredited Accreditation Options
Numerous organizations use nationally identified certifications after finishing their programs-- useful credentials for prospective employers needing first aid qualifications.
Cons of In-Person CPR Courses
Fixed Set up Requirements
Classes are frequently scheduled at specific times; this can conflict with other commitments making it much less hassle-free contrasted to versatile on the internet options.
Travel Costs & Time Consumption
Travelling adds additional prices (fuel/transport) in addition to lost time traveling back-and-forth from class locations.
